☐ Mail room relocation (night shift briefing for new starters). The mail room has moved from Ground Floor East to Basement Level 1 at Hartvale Point, next to the loading dock roller door. Show the new starter the new sorting benches, the outbound cage, and the franking station, and explain that the old room is now off limits while Pellow Fitouts finish the strip-out. To open the basement mail room after hours, they will need the code below.

turnstile pass: bdg-JVSWH-52711

**Checklist: SeatScape renderer — Orpheon Theatre launch**

- Verify balcony tier renders without overlap at all zoom levels.
- Confirm accessible-seat icons load on slow connections.
- Check hold/release flow against staging inventory.
- Sign-off from Priya required before flipping the flag.

New folks: record the renderer build you tested against; it's the token shown below.

pipeline stamp: htk31_f769b577b3028a4e9958e5bb8d1259a

## Configuration: Timezones in Exports

All report exports from Quartzline default to UTC. Override per-tenant via REPORT_TZ in the env file. Do not rely on host timezone; the exporter ignores it. DST transitions are handled by the bundled tzdata snapshot. The export signer also requires its signing secret on the next line.

vault entry, yahif-yajep: COURIER_KEY29=b802bdf8034096b65a51c6ba5abe2

MEMO — Kettling Depot Receiving

Uniform sets for the new Kettling depot arrive Wednesday via Ashgrove courier: 40 boxes, sorted by size, manifest attached to box one. Check the count at the dock before signing; shortages go straight to stores, not the courier. The hand-over instruction the courier will follow is set out below.

drop instructions, tafof-baguf: the holmir gilox courier leaves the sormir ulaok holdor ledger at gate 5596 under passcode 257343

During the Fenwold mall outage, the kiosk watchdog restarted the shell app in a tight loop because its health probe succeeded even while the renderer was frozen. Future maintainers should know the probe now checks frame liveness, not just process presence, and restarts are rate-limited with exponential backoff. Changing any of these values requires sign-off from the Lanternbox on-call lead, since overly eager restarts corrupt the local order cache. The current watchdog constants are recorded below.

tuning table, fahog-yagep:
RATE_LIMITS = {
    "ulaath": 2,
    "druix": 1,
}